Introduction

Affordable daycare is a pressing concern for families nationwide, while the cost of childcare consistently rise. With more moms and dads going into the workforce and needing trustworthy care for kids, the option of affordable daycare became an essential consider deciding the commercial security of many people. This observational study aims to explore the impact of inexpensive daycare on people, concentrating on the advantages and difficulties that include use of quality, affordable childcare.

Methodology

Because of this research, observational research practices were utilized to collect data in the experiences of families with inexpensive daycare. A sample of 50 households was selected from different socio-economic experiences, with a variety of childcare needs and choices. Members were interviewed about their particular experiences with affordable daycare, like the costs, top-notch attention, and general affect their loved ones dynamics. Observations were also made at daycare facilities to evaluate the standard of care offered additionally the communications between young ones, caregivers, and moms and dads.

Outcomes

The outcomes for the research disclosed a range of benefits and challenges of affordable daycare. Families stated that use of inexpensive childcare allowed them to function full time, pursue higher education, and take on extra responsibilities without fretting about the price of care. Numerous parents additionally noted that kids benefited from socialization and academic possibilities provided by daycare facilities, which assisted them develop important abilities and prepare for school.

However, difficulties were in addition reported, including restricted accessibility to affordable daycare in certain areas, lengthy waitlists for high quality services, and issues about the quality of treatment supplied. Some families noted that they needed to make sacrifices in other aspects of their particular budget to pay for childcare, although some indicated disappointment because of the lack of freedom in daycare hours or even the lack of social or language-specific programs for children.

Overall, the effect of inexpensive daycare on people ended up being mainly positive, with many parents expressing gratitude for the assistance and sources supplied Daycares By Category childcare services. But there clearly was nonetheless a necessity for more inexpensive options and better ease of access for families in need of quality take care of kids.
